When EGTA (Ca〓 chelator), Verapmil and LaCl〓(Ca〓 channel blockers) were used to treat tomato fruit at green mature and strawberry fruit at white stage with ethylene, they could reverse ethylene-induced increase in ethylene production in tomato and strawberry, PG activity, lycopene content, soluble protein content in cell wall in tomato and degradation in soluble protein in strawberry, which indicated blocking Ca〓 channel in plasma membrane or chelating Ca〓 can decrease intracellular Ca〓, further inhibite ethylene-induced maturation, ripening and senescence of fruit.
用质膜钙通道阻断剂异博定、钙通道Ca〓竞争性抑制剂以及Ca〓专一性螯合剂与乙烯一起处理绿熟期番茄果实和乳白期草莓果实,均可抑制乙烯诱导番茄和草莓的乙烯生成、番茄PG活性的提高、番茄红素含量的增加和细胞壁可溶性蛋白含量的增加以及草莓可溶性蛋白的分解,表明阻断质膜Ca〓通道或螯合胞外Ca〓以减少胞内Ca〓能抑制乙烯对果实的催熟作用,间接证明乙烯对果实成熟衰老的诱导与胞外Ca〓内流引起的胞质Ca〓浓度的增加密切相关,表明乙烯信号转导可能与钙信使有关,调节胞质Ca〓浓度可调节乙烯对果实的催熟作用。

Grew on the normal temperature, it was shown that the deposits of calcium antimonate being the indicator for Ca(superscript 2+) localization mainly concentrated within the vacuoles and intercellular spaces and there was also some Ca(superscript 2+) deposits in cell walls. But when Garyota urens L. was treated by the temperature of 2℃ for 48 h, the level of Ca(superscript 2+) increased in cytoplasm and plasma membrane, but decreased in vacuoles and intercellular spaces considerably. At the same time, the ultrastructure of chloroplasts suffered from chilling: the membrane of chloroplasts had been damaged, the layer of thylakoids was exiguous and unclear, the photosynthetic rate decreased evidently. And when Garyota urens L. was treated by the temperature of 2℃ for 120 h, the deposits of Ca(superscript 2+) mainly concentrated within the cytoplasm, nucleus and plasma membrane and there was also some Ca(superscript 2+) deposits in vacuoles, and the ultrastructure of some cells was simultaneously damaged severely: Chloroplasts structure, vacuole membrane and nuclear membrane had been damaged fully, the structure within the cell had become unclear, and the cell only have respiration.
研究结果表明,未经低温处理的董棕幼苗叶肉细胞,焦锑酸钙沉淀颗粒大量出现在液泡和细胞间隙中,细胞壁中也可见少量沉淀,而细胞基质中则看不到焦锑酸钙沉淀;经2℃ 48 h低温处理后,细胞基质和细胞膜上焦锑酸钙沉淀增加,而液泡和细胞间隙中的焦锑酸钙沉淀则显著减少,并且超微结构已初步显示出寒害的特徵,叶绿体外膜部分破损,类囊体片层稀疏且排列不规则,光合速率明显下降等;经2℃ 120 h低温处理后,细胞间隙内的焦锑酸钙沉淀极少,有的也紧贴在细胞外壁上,而细胞基质和细胞膜上则分布有非常多的焦锑酸钙沉淀,在核基质和液泡中也可见到少量的焦锑酸钙沉淀,并且超微结构遭到了显著破坏,叶绿体结构完全被破坏,核膜与液泡膜严重破损,内部结构模糊,细胞只表现为呼吸作用,不进行光合作用。

Ca is widely abundant in nature and its rodioisotope 41 Ca is a cosmogenic nuclide with a half\|life of 10 5 years. However, the 41 Ca/ 40 Ca ratio in natural samples is very low and can only be measure d by accelerator mass spectrometry. The application of 41 Ca is ve ry i mportant not only in the life science but also in geological dating, global envi ronment change studies and astrophysics.
1 引言Ca在自然界中广泛存在,它不仅是人体中含量最丰富的元素之一[1] ,也是众多其他物质的组成部分。41Ca(半衰期为 1.0 3× 10 5a)属于Ca的放射性同位素中的一种,其衰变方式为轨道电子俘获,只发射3.3keV的X射线,天然样品中41Ca 40 Ca的值很小。
